Types of Mercedes Keys
Keys are not simply tools for beginning a vehicle; they work as gateways to a suite of functionalities in contemporary Mercedes-Benz cars and trucks. Here are the main kinds of keys offered by Mercedes:
1. Conventional Mechanical Keys
- Description: The initial style of keys that runs with a basic lock and ignition system.
- Models Used: Early designs, mostly from the early 1900s to the late 1990s.
2. SmartKey
- Description: An advanced key fob geared up with buttons for locking, opening, and trunk release. It also integrates an infrared system for remote gain access to and start.
- Models Used: Introduced in 1998, utilized in numerous models throughout the late 1990s and early 2000s.
3. KEYLESS-GO
- Description: A keyless entry system that permits drivers to unlock and start their car without removing the key fob from their pocket or handbag.
- Designs Used: Available in many more recent designs from the mid-2000s to present.
4. Digital Key
- Description: A smartphone-based key that allows users to control their automobile utilizing an app, in addition to unlock and begin the car via Bluetooth.
- Models Used: Keyless innovation introduced from 2015 and further boosted in current models.

Functions of the Mercedes Key System
Mercedes-Benz keys are filled with functions that increase convenience, security, and in some cases even satisfaction for the motorist.
Security Features
- Anti-theft Technology: Modern keys include distinct security codes that alter with each usage, making them hard to replicate.
- Immobilizer System: This electronic system prevents the engine from starting unless the proper key is used.
Convenience Features
- Remote Functions: Many models enable users to lock or unlock their vehicles from a distance.
- Panic Button: Activates the automobile's alarm system, drawing attention in case of an emergency situation.
Connection Features
- Mercedes Me App Integration: Users can control numerous functions of their car through the app, consisting of locking/unlocking, vehicle tracking, and more.
- Digital Key Functions: Accessing your automobile using a compatible smart device makes traditional keys progressively obsolete.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How do I configure a replacement key for my Mercedes?
To set a replacement key, you'll need to provide your automobile recognition number (VIN) and proof of ownership to an authorized Mercedes-Benz dealer. They generally handle the programming with innovative equipment.
2. Can I use my smartphone as a key?
Yes, if your model supports digital key functionality, you can use the Mercedes Me app to unlock and begin your lorry using your smartphone.

4. Is it safe to use keyless entry systems?
Yes, keyless entry systems are typically thought about safe; however, it's essential to remain notified about progressing security threats and regularly check your vehicle's systems.
